The UK must harness the power of advanced manufacturing

SMMT

Vital for the UK economy, the M5 sectors span life sciences, chemicals, food and drink, automotive, aerospace, defence, security and space, and employ nearly one million people in roles that are 46% more productive than the national average. It stresses the need for a coherent, long-term strategy to ensure their continued success.
